American screenwriter and film producer


Michelle Ashford (born 1960) is an American screenwriter and film producer. She is best known for her Emmy-nominated writing for the 2010 Miniseries The Pacific.[1][2][3] In 2013, Ashford's TV series Masters of Sex debuted in the US on Showtime.

Personal life

Ashford is married to television writer and producer Greg Walker, who she met while he was working for her.[4] The couple have two children together.[5]
